Use of mobile phones by prisoners totally impermissible: HC

The Delhi High Court on Wednesday said use of mobile phones by prisoners is totally impermissible and directed Tihar jail authorities to install jammers in various places to prevent their use of cell phones. A Division Bench of Chief Justice Dipak Misra and Justice Manmohan said in an order that jail authorities have to strictly comply with the direction of the court or they have to face the consequences. In an order in May, the court had directed the Director General (Prisons) to confiscate all mobile phones and also told him not to allow any visitor to carry a cell phone during meeting hours with prisoners. The Chief Metropolitan Magistrate had ordered an inquiry after an under trial came to the courtroom with a SIM card hidden in his mouth and lodged a complaint with the court saying cellphones were being used inside the jail.
